Job Summary

Begin your career journey with us and start changing lives today as a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ant (COTA). As an Occupational Therapy Assistant, you would work under the supervision of an Occupational Therapist to improve residents' quality of life and ability to perform daily activities by assisting with therapy activities and exercises scheduled in a treatment plan. Here you’ll be given the opportunity to use and develop skills like problem-solving, communication, and creativity while delivering quality, holistic care as a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ant (COTA).

Responsibilities

  • Selects, implements, and modifies activities and interventions that are consistent with demonstrated competency levels and goals
  • Exchanges information with and provides documentation to the occupational therapist
  • Knowledgeable about the patient's/resident's targeted occupational therapy outcomes

Qualifications

  • Appropriate education level required in accordance with state licensure
  • Must be licensed as an Occupational Therapy Assistant in the state(s) of practice
  • When working at a Sanford Health Facility (not required but preferred for GSS Facilities): Must also be certified as an Occupational Therapy Assistant through the National Board for Certification in Occupational Therapy (NBCOT)
  • Conforms to the supervision and licensing standards of the state(s) where services are provided
